You can buy a kit called the disco-antistat , made by a German company , for around £60 . This is the best kit you'll get without having the expense of a professional machine . You should be able to get a Disco-antitstat on line and it should last you a lifetime as long as you keep buying the fluid for it.

Looks great but an absolute pain in the tits to empty back n the bottle, going by YouTube reviews
